by Sabre6
No, the portable power supply plug's directly into the VT3 system and it also power's the speaker which is already programed with the eye warble and you can speak while the warble is playing. So you don't need a separate system like a cd or mp3 loop with the eye warble. I'm still working on fine tuning the mounting of everything , so if anyone has any pic's or suggestion's feel free to let me know. I'm planning on testing it at our next convention in Baltimore in 2 week's. Not sure how long the power supply will last but it use's a USB cable to charge and I might get a spare power supply just incase. I also have a MP3 and wireless speaker as backup.

Posted: Fri Aug 26, 2016 2:56 am
by dorns
I have had the Anker supply running for more than an hour with it and I see the charge still strong showing 4 lights. I think it could easily outlast a typical troop out. The VT3 uses 380mAh. The battery is 10000Mah, pretty sure it will last the day!
